Device Credentials
The Device Credentials page enables you to provide the credentials required to connect and identify the device.
The following table describes the fields displayed in the Device Credentials page.
Table 30. Device Credentials
Field Description
Username The username of a user account that has administrative or
elevated privileges on the device.
Password The password of a user account that has administrative or
elevated privileges on the device.
Enable Password The enable password configured on the device.
Community String The community string configured on the device.
NOTE: The Enable Password and Community String are applicable only for Dell Networking devices.
NOTE: The Community String is also applicable for Dell EqualLogic storage arrays.
NOTE: Device credentials are not required for adding Dell PowerVault devices. Therefore, the Device Credentials page is
not displayed when you add a PowerVault device.
